Udemy
    •  
    •  
    •  
    •  
    •  
    •  
    •  
    •  
Turn what you know into an opportunity and reach millions around the world.
Learn More
Your cart is empty.
Keep shopping
JavaScript na Essência: Curso Completo com 5 Projetos Reais
Rating: 4.7 out of 5(657 ratings)
2,834 students

JavaScript na Essência: Curso Completo com 5 Projetos Reais

Vá além de frameworks. Seja um Desenvolvedor Eficiente Dominando JavaScript Puro na Prática com POO, Regex, DOM e mais!
Last updated 6/2026
Portuguese

What you'll learn

  • Domine JavaScript do ZERO ao avançado, aprendendo profundamente a linguagem e suas principais aplicações no mercado de trabalho.
  • Como identificar e tratar erros no JavaScript, garantindo aplicações robustas e confiáveis.
  • Manipule o DOM (Document Object Model): Crie páginas web interativas e dinâmicas com JavaScript puro.
  • Programação Orientada a Objetos (POO): Aprenda a estruturar e organizar seu código de forma profissional.
  • Expressões Regulares (Regex): Realize buscas, validações e substituições com eficiência e precisão.
  • Programação Assíncrona: Trabalhe com callbacks, promises, async/await e AJAX para criar aplicações modernas e ágeis.
  • HTML e CSS Integrados: Crie interfaces de usuário atraentes e fáceis de usar como base para projetos reais.
  • Vá além de frameworks aprendendo JavaScript puro com foco em boas práticas e eficiência no desenvolvimento.
  • onstrua 5 projetos reais aplicando os conceitos mais relevantes para se destacar no mercado de trabalho.

Course content

20 sections241 lectures20h 34m total length
  • A Rota do SEU SUCESSO para Dominar o JavaScript5:17
  • Perguntas Frequentes1:31
  • Uma Breve História do JavaScript3:10
  • IMPORTANTE0:26
  • Melhorando sua experiência no curso: Perguntas e respostas0:44
  • Onde JavaScript é Usado?3:25
  • Instalação do Chrome3:13
  • Instalação do VSCode7:43

Requirements

  • Nenhuma experiência prévia com JavaScript ou programação é necessária. Você aprenderá tudo do ZERO.
  • Acesso a um computador com navegador e editor de texto para praticar.
  • Vontade de aprender e se destacar no mercado de tecnologia!

Description

Domine JavaScript e Conquiste o Mercado de Trabalho de Tecnologia!

Imagine-se preparado para ingressar no super aquecido mercado de tecnologia, aumentar seu salário, alavancar sua carreira e desenvolver as habilidades que as empresas mais valorizam.


"JavaScript é a linguagem mais popular no mercado de trabalho pelo oitavo ano consecutivo."
Stack Overflow 2020 Developer Survey


Por que aprender JavaScript?
Grandes empresas como Facebook, Google, Amazon, Twitter e Microsoft utilizam JavaScript diariamente. Além disso, é uma linguagem versátil: pode ser usada para criar aplicativos web e móveis, tanto no frontend quanto no backend.


E o melhor: JavaScript é simples de aprender comparado a linguagens como Java ou C++, mas poderoso o suficiente para construir sistemas robustos e dinâmicos.

Pronto para dar o próximo passo na sua carreira?


--

DICA IMPORTANTE: em vez de adquirir apenas este curso, considere o plano de assinatura da Udemy. Assim, você garante acesso não apenas a este treinamento, mas também a todos os meus cursos disponíveis na plataforma, além de milhares de outros conteúdos de alto nível. É a melhor forma de turbinar sua formação com um investimento ainda mais inteligente.

--


Por que escolher este curso?

  1. Do básico ao avançado:
    Aprenda tudo sobre JavaScript, desde fundamentos como variáveis, loops e funções até temas avançados como POO, DOM, AJAX e padrões de projeto.

  2. Foco na prática:
    Desenvolva 5 projetos reais que simulam desafios do mercado, incluindo um clone da Netflix e um sistema e-commerce.

  3. Curso enxuto e organizado:
    Ao invés de cursos longos e genéricos, este curso é focado nos tópicos mais relevantes para maximizar seu tempo e retorno sobre o investimento.

  4. JavaScript moderno (ES6+):
    Domine as melhorias da linguagem e aprenda recursos como arrow functions, promises, async/await e mais.

  5. Orientação a Objetos e Padrões de Projeto:
    Torne-se um desenvolvedor confiante ao aprender boas práticas e conceitos que facilitam o trabalho em grandes projetos.

  6. Didática eficiente:
    Técnicas de ensino comprovadas para garantir que você realmente aprenda e retenha o conhecimento.

  7. Omni Academy:
    Mais de 450.000 alunos já confiam em nossos cursos, best-sellers na Udemy.

O que você vai aprender?

  • Fundamentos do JavaScript: variáveis, funções e estruturas de controle.

  • Estruturas de dados: arrays, objetos e manipulação de dados complexos.

  • DOM e manipulação de eventos: crie páginas interativas e dinâmicas.

  • Programação assíncrona: callback, promises, async/await e AJAX.

  • Expressões regulares (Regex): busque e valide dados com eficiência.

  • POO e padrões de projeto: desenvolva códigos organizados e reutilizáveis.

Projetos Reais:

  1. Jogo da Forca: Desenvolva lógica de jogo, manipulação de eventos e interações dinâmicas.

  2. Currículo Web: Crie uma página de currículo aplicando HTML, CSS e boas práticas de design.

  3. To-Do List: Construa um sistema funcional para organizar tarefas com personalização e manipulação do DOM.

  4. Clone da Netflix: Busque e exiba informações de filmes utilizando APIs e programação assíncrona.

  5. Sistema E-commerce: Valide dados, implemente preenchimento automático e crie funcionalidades de cadastro usando Regex e AJAX.

Garantia de Satisfação:

Este curso inclui 30 dias de garantia! Se não estiver satisfeito, devolvemos seu dinheiro sem perguntas.


Depoimentos dos alunos:
"Ótimo curso! Didática incrível e projetos práticos que realmente fazem a diferença." — Vinicius Delmo
"Aprendi do zero e já consigo desenvolver meus próprios projetos. Excelente professor!" — Enzo Homme


O que você está esperando?
Garanta sua vaga agora e dê o próximo passo para dominar JavaScript e se destacar no mercado de trabalho!

Who this course is for:

  • Iniciantes que nunca programaram e desejam aprender sua primeira linguagem de programação. JavaScript é uma ótima escolha!
  • Programadores com experiência em outras linguagens, como Python ou Java, que desejam dominar JavaScript para ampliar suas habilidades.
  • Desenvolvedores que se sentem limitados e dependentes de frameworks JavaScript e desejam compreender a linguagem de forma profunda e eficiente.
  • Desenvolvedores com conhecimentos básicos de JavaScript que buscam aprimorar suas habilidades e criar projetos avançados.